In this thread I have been informed that the French 7800 units have RGB outputs.

 

Has any one got the schematics for French 7800 units, or at least the video output section?

 

I would like to see if it would be possible to modify my normal RF only PAL unit to output RGB.icon_lust.gif

 

The problem with the French units is they use a 13 pin din socket for the RGB out, I would like to use a panel mounting SCART socket.

They use a standard PAL 7800 with the RF modulator removed and a special RGB board in it's place. I'm not aware of any schematics for it and considering how many jumpers are on that thing it might be a pain to draw up.

I doubt a standard SCART socket would fit very well unless you totally cut up the back of the 7800. The 13 pin DIN to SCART cable that it comes with works just fine.

The 7800PAL uses a Sony V7021 video processor and a delay to create an RGB encoder (though I think they removed the delay in the final design) - also I think there was a capacitance issue when using Peritel cables.
